It doesn't really matter. Robert, if I remove the flag, will you remove the
-1 on the PR?

On Wed, May 7, 2025 at 10:43 AM Dmitri Bourlatchkov <di...@apache.org>
wrote:

> On Wed, May 7, 2025 at 11:29 AM Robert Stupp <sn...@snazy.de> wrote:
>
> > If federated principals cannot be created, it doesn't make sense to me
> > to even have that flag.
> >
>
> I think Robert has a point here. Still, from my POV (as I commented in GH
> [1])
> exposing the same property in PrincipalRole and Principal at the same time
> also
> has merit, that is to keep API "symmetric" because those entities are
> related
> as far as Identity Federation is concerned, and we do expect potentially
> importing
> Principals later.
>
> I'm fine with both approaches (property in both entities now or property
> just in role
> now and in Principal when absolutely necessary).
>
> [1]
> https://github.com/apache/polaris/pull/1353#pullrequestreview-2819283769
>
> Cheers,
> Dmitri.
>

Reply via email to